Replacing a toilet is a common home improvement project that many homeowners consider tackling on their own. While it’s not as complex as some plumbing tasks, it does require a certain level of skill and attention to detail. So, do you have to be a licensed plumber to replace a toilet? Let’s break it down.
Can You Replace a Toilet Yourself?
Yes, you can replace a toilet yourself if you’re comfortable with basic plumbing tasks and have the right tools. Many homeowners successfully install new toilets as a DIY project. However, it’s important to assess your skills and the scope of the project before diving in.
Here are the steps involved in replacing a toilet:
- Turn Off the Water Supply
- Shut off the water supply to the toilet and drain the tank.
- Remove the Old Toilet
- Unscrew the bolts securing the toilet to the floor, disconnect the water line, and carefully lift the old toilet away.
- Inspect and Replace the Wax Ring
- Clean the flange area and replace the wax ring, which seals the base of the toilet to the drain.
- Install the New Toilet
- Position the new toilet over the flange, secure it with bolts, reconnect the water line, and test for leaks.
When Should You Call a Plumber?
While replacing a toilet is a straightforward process for experienced DIYers, there are situations where calling a professional plumber is the smarter choice:
- Complicated Plumbing Setup
- Older homes or custom bathroom layouts may have unusual plumbing configurations that require expertise.
- Damaged or Misaligned Flange
- If the toilet flange (the fitting that connects the toilet to the drain pipe) is damaged, corroded, or misaligned, a plumber may need to repair or replace it.
- Water Leaks or Poor Installation
- Improperly installed toilets can lead to water leaks, rocking toilets, or damage to your flooring. A professional plumber ensures the job is done right the first time.
- Compliance with Building Codes
- In some areas, plumbing installations must comply with local building codes, which may require a licensed plumber to perform the work.
- Time and Convenience
- If you’re short on time or don’t want to deal with the mess and hassle, hiring a plumber is a stress-free solution.
